The Position of Salivary Glands and Their Dysfunction

The salivary glands, a community of specialised organs, are liable for the manufacturing and secretion of saliva, an important fluid for oral well being. At a mobile degree, the method of saliva manufacturing is a posh interaction of assorted mechanisms.The first salivary glands, together with the parotid, submandibular, and sublingual glands, are composed of acinar cells. These cells, wealthy in endoplasmic reticulum and Golgi equipment, are liable for synthesizing and secreting the first elements of saliva: water, electrolytes, and varied proteins.

The method begins with the filtration of blood plasma into the acinar cells. Water and electrolytes are actively transported throughout the cell membranes, creating an osmotic gradient. The protein synthesis is then initiated to create proteins reminiscent of amylase (for carbohydrate digestion), mucins (for lubrication), and immunoglobulins (for immune protection).Salivary gland dysfunction can stem from varied causes, usually resulting in a discount in saliva manufacturing.

Injury to the acinar cells, whether or not as a result of autoimmune illnesses, radiation remedy, or infections, immediately impairs their capability to supply saliva. Nerve harm, affecting the autonomic nervous system that controls salivary gland perform, may also considerably cut back saliva move. The consequence of decreased saliva manufacturing is a cascade of detrimental results on oral well being. The protecting capabilities of saliva, reminiscent of lubricating the oral tissues, neutralizing acids, and washing away meals particles, are diminished.

This will increase the danger of tooth decay, because the protecting buffering capability of saliva is diminished, permitting acids produced by micro organism to erode tooth enamel. Gum illness, together with gingivitis and periodontitis, can also be exacerbated as a result of saliva helps management bacterial overgrowth and gives antimicrobial elements. Moreover, dry mouth can result in difficulties in swallowing, talking, and carrying dentures, affecting total high quality of life.

In extreme instances, it will possibly contribute to oral infections and ulcers.

Totally different Forms of Salivary Gland Issues and Their Signs

Varied problems can have an effect on the salivary glands, resulting in dry mouth as a outstanding symptom. Every dysfunction presents with particular signs and requires distinct diagnostic approaches.The next record particulars the several types of salivary gland problems:

  • Sjögren’s Syndrome: This autoimmune illness primarily targets the salivary and lacrimal glands. Key signs embrace persistent dry mouth and dry eyes. Diagnostic strategies contain blood checks to detect particular antibodies (anti-SSA and anti-SSB), salivary gland biopsy to evaluate lymphocytic infiltration, and salivary move charge measurements.
  • Sialadenitis: This refers to irritation of the salivary glands, usually attributable to bacterial or viral infections. Signs embrace swelling, ache, and tenderness within the affected gland, together with diminished saliva move. Prognosis usually includes bodily examination, imaging strategies like ultrasound or CT scans, and, generally, aspiration of the gland.
  • Salivary Gland Tumors: Each benign and malignant tumors can have an effect on the salivary glands. Signs can range, together with a painless lump or swelling within the gland, facial ache, and, in some instances, dry mouth. Prognosis includes bodily examination, imaging (MRI or CT scans), and biopsy for definitive analysis.
  • Sialolithiasis (Salivary Stones): The formation of stones inside the salivary ducts can impede saliva move, resulting in ache, swelling, and dry mouth, significantly throughout meals. Prognosis sometimes includes bodily examination, imaging (X-rays, ultrasound, or sialography), and infrequently, sialoendoscopy to visualise and take away the stones.

Varied medical situations and medicines contribute to dry mouth. Sure medical situations and medicines can considerably contribute to xerostomia.The next bullet factors element these situations and medicines:

  • Medical Circumstances: Autoimmune illnesses like Sjögren’s syndrome, rheumatoid arthritis, and lupus are steadily related to dry mouth as a result of irritation and harm to salivary glands. Diabetes, uncontrolled, may also result in dehydration and decreased saliva manufacturing.
  • Drugs: Many widespread medicines have dry mouth as a aspect impact.
    • Anticholinergics: These medication, used to deal with situations like overactive bladder and Parkinson’s illness, block the motion of ac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ter that stimulates saliva manufacturing. Examples embrace oxybutynin and benztropine.
    • Antidepressants: Tricyclic antidepressants and sel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RIs) can cut back saliva move. Examples embrace amitriptyline and fluoxetine.
    • Antihistamines: Generally used to deal with allergy symptoms, these medication even have anticholinergic results. Examples embrace diphenhydramine and cetirizine.
    • Antihypertensives: Sure blood strain medicines, like diuretics and beta-blockers, can contribute to dry mouth. Examples embrace hydrochlorothiazide and metoprolol.

The Impression of Age and Life-style Selections on Saliva Manufacturing

Age and way of life decisions considerably affect saliva manufacturing and the danger of dry mouth. As people age, salivary gland perform tends to say no, resulting in diminished saliva move. This decline will not be solely as a result of growing old itself but in addition the cumulative results of medicines, persistent illnesses, and modifications in oral well being habits that usually accompany growing old. Life-style decisions, significantly smoking and alcohol consumption, can additional exacerbate the issue.

Smoking damages salivary gland tissues and reduces saliva manufacturing, whereas alcohol acts as a diuretic, resulting in dehydration and diminished saliva move.The next desk illustrates the assorted levels of dry mouth severity and their corresponding signs, together with recommendation for these experiencing these levels:

Sugar Substitutes: Xylitol, Sorbitol, and Mannitol

The cornerstone of sugar-free gum’s attraction lies in its use of sugar substitutes. These options present sweetness with out contributing to tooth decay. Nevertheless, their influence extends past simply oral well being, influencing style and doubtlessly inflicting unwanted effects.

  • Xylitol: This naturally occurring sugar alcohol, discovered in lots of vegetables and fruit, is a standout performer. It is a potent cavity fighter as a result of it inhibits the expansion of Streptococcus mutans, the first micro organism liable for tooth decay. Research have proven that common xylitol use can considerably cut back plaque formation. Xylitol’s sweetness is akin to sucrose (desk sugar), providing a well-recognized style profile.

    Nevertheless, extreme consumption can result in digestive points, reminiscent of bloating and diarrhea, significantly for these unaccustomed to sugar alcohols. The advisable day by day consumption to realize oral well being advantages sometimes ranges from 5 to 10 grams, unfold all through the day.

  • Sorbitol: One other widespread sugar alcohol, sorbitol is derived from fruits like apples and pears. It is much less candy than sucrose and xylitol, leading to a barely completely different style notion. Whereas sorbitol can also be thought-about non-cariogenic (would not trigger cavities), its effectiveness in stopping tooth decay is much less pronounced in comparison with xylitol. Sorbitol is usually utilized in mixture with different sweeteners to boost the general taste profile.

    Like xylitol, sorbitol may cause digestive upset if consumed in massive portions, as a result of its slower absorption charge within the small gut.

  • Mannitol: This sugar alcohol can also be present in nature, usually extracted from seaweed. It is much less candy than each xylitol and sorbitol. Mannitol is steadily used as a bulking agent and to enhance the feel of gum. Whereas it’s thought-about non-cariogenic, it is not as efficient as xylitol in stopping tooth decay. Mannitol has the next potential for inflicting digestive misery than xylitol and sorbitol, significantly at larger doses.

    It will possibly additionally act as a diuretic, doubtlessly resulting in dehydration in some people.

The selection of sugar substitute considerably impacts the general expertise. Xylitol, with its superior oral well being advantages and comparable sweetness to sugar, usually takes the lead. Nevertheless, particular person tolerance ranges range, and the potential for digestive unwanted effects needs to be thought-about.

Extra Elements for Dry Mouth Aid

Past sugar substitutes, a number of different elements contribute to the effectiveness of sugar-free gum in managing dry mouth. These elements goal completely different points of oral dryness, from stimulating saliva manufacturing to offering soothing aid.

  • Moisturizing Brokers: Elements like glycerin and lecithin assist to retain moisture and lubricate the oral cavity. Glycerin, a humectant, attracts and holds water, retaining the mouth feeling much less dry. Lecithin, a phospholipid, aids in coating the oral tissues, offering a soothing impact. These brokers create a extra comfy surroundings, significantly for people with extreme dry mouth.
  • Flavorings: Flavorings, reminiscent of peppermint, spearmint, or fruit extracts, play an important position in stimulating saliva manufacturing. The act of chewing and the sensory stimulation of flavors set off the salivary glands. Sure flavors are simpler than others at selling saliva move. For instance, citrus flavors are typically significantly efficient as a result of their tartness.
  • Saliva Stimulants: Some gums incorporate elements particularly designed to stimulate saliva manufacturing. Malic acid, a standard meals additive, can improve saliva move. These elements work by activating the salivary glands, growing the quantity of saliva launched into the mouth. This may be particularly helpful for these experiencing diminished saliva manufacturing.
  • Emulsifiers and Stabilizers: Elements reminiscent of gum base, used to supply the gum’s texture, and stabilizers like cellulose gum assist to keep up the integrity of the gum and guarantee a constant chewing expertise.

These extra elements work synergistically to supply a complete method to dry mouth aid. They improve saliva manufacturing, moisturize the oral cavity, and enhance the general consolation of the mouth.

Gastrointestinal Facet Results of Sugar Alcohols

Extreme consumption of sugar alcohols, widespread in sugar-free gum, can result in gastrointestinal misery. These elements, like xylitol and sorbitol, are poorly absorbed within the small gut. This can lead to elevated water retention within the intestine and fermentation by intestine micro organism, producing gasoline.This is how these results manifest and handle them:* Bloating and Fuel: The fermentation course of generates gasoline, resulting in bloating and discomfort.

The severity varies amongst people.

Diarrhea

Unabsorbed sugar alcohols draw water into the colon, doubtlessly inflicting diarrhea. That is extra seemingly with excessive doses.

Belly Cramps

Muscle spasms within the digestive tract could happen.To attenuate these results, think about the next methods:* Gradual Introduction: Begin with small quantities of sugar-free gum to permit your digestive system to regulate. Start with one or two items per day and step by step enhance the quantity over a number of weeks, monitoring for any antagonistic reactions.

Ingredient Consciousness

Learn labels fastidiously. Determine the sugar alcohols used (xylitol, sorbitol, mannitol, and so forth.) and their concentrations.

Select Decrease Concentrations

Go for gums with decrease ranges of sugar alcohols. Some manufacturers supply choices with diminished sugar alcohol content material.

Monitor Your Consumption

Take note of your physique’s response. If you happen to expertise gastrointestinal signs, cut back your gum consumption or discontinue use.

Hydration

Drink loads of water. This might help to alleviate a few of the digestive discomfort.For instance, a research printed in theJournal of the American Dietetic Affiliation* discovered that consuming greater than 50 grams of sorbitol per day might result in diarrhea in some people. This highlights the significance of moderation and consciousness of ingredient quantities.

Query Financial institution

What causes dry mouth?

Dry mouth, or xerostomia, has many causes. These can embrace medicines (antidepressants, antihistamines, and so forth.), sure medical situations (Sjögren’s syndrome, diabetes), radiation remedy to the top and neck, and dehydration. Ageing may also contribute, and way of life elements like smoking and alcohol consumption play a task.

Is all sugar-free gum equally efficient for dry mouth?

No, the effectiveness of sugar-free gum varies. Search for gums containing xylitol, which has been proven to stimulate saliva manufacturing and supply oral well being advantages. Elements, taste profiles, and the absence of sure components may also influence its effectiveness for dry mouth aid.

Can sugar-free gum trigger any unwanted effects?

Sure, some individuals expertise gastrointestinal points, reminiscent of bloating, gasoline, or diarrhea, particularly with extreme consumption of sugar alcohols like xylitol or sorbitol. It is suggested to start out with a small quantity of gum and step by step enhance consumption. These with ir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) ought to train warning.

How usually ought to I chew sugar-free gum for dry mouth?

The frequency depends upon your particular person wants and the severity of your dry mouth. Chewing sugar-free gum a number of instances a day, significantly after meals or once you really feel dryness, is mostly advisable. Take heed to your physique and regulate the frequency as wanted.

Can sugar-free gum exchange different dry mouth therapies?

Sugar-free gum is usually a useful a part of a dry mouth remedy plan, nevertheless it is probably not enough by itself. It is usually finest used at the side of different cures, reminiscent of ingesting loads of water, utilizing a humidifier, and, if wanted, prescription saliva stimulants or synthetic saliva merchandise. Seek the advice of with a dentist or physician for a complete plan.
